Advertisement

Results for "Category: Custom Controls/ Forms/ Menus"

ASP_Volume3 #58073
FormBar

Ever wanted to create a tray bar for your MDIChild forms that looks like windows tray? or just tired to use Windows menu to switch beetween child forms? or just want to improve the looks of your app... Here is an example of how to create a form bar (a'la tray) to place in a mdi form. it doesn't use any api to detect forms and stuff, only old fasion Visual Basic event model. all u have to do is invoke ONE sub to add a form to the bar, and the rest will be done automatically. I have tested this control only in a MDI app, you are welcome to try its functionality in a SDI app, and leave your comments. Menu functions are not implemented fully, cause i couldn't decide how... Well u can add a custom menu, but control doesn't raise any event when a button is clicked. It's up to u to figure out and implement such functionality. Have fun (and rate!!!)

ASP_Volume3 #58075
Emulate splitter bars - very simple - pure VB no APIs!!!

This sample demonstrates how to emulate splitter bars using VB

ASP_Volume3 #58081
A Trayicon usercontrol. Use it where ever you want.

Add, Remove, Change icon in your systemtray. This usercontrol is absolutly great, you can use it where ever you want. It also has Events for MouseUp, MouseDown and MouseMove. Please Vote...

ASP_Volume3 #58105
Ripple Effect

This is an ripple effect (well, it seems to be), which uses pure VB. My friends say, they look like ripples, but I don't. Just Hold the mouse over the form and move it.

ASP_Volume3 #58118
VB Control Manager

VB Control Manager is an ActiveX control to allow the user to dock controls and resize, move and show/hide them at run-time. This is actually the improvement of my VB Splitter, an ActiveX control to resize docked controls at run-time. I change the name because VB Control Manager can do a lot of more than just to split/resize control. VB Control Manager has 14 properties, 4 methods, and 18 events customly made, plus two collection: a Controls collection (with 20 properties) and a Splitters collection (with 27 properties). To use the control, just place the VB Control Manager control on your form and add several controls on it. That's it! You don't have to add any codes to your form to have basic features of VB Control Manager. Just don't miss the demo (open the VB Control Manager Demo.vbg). Your feedback and votes will be very appreciated.

ASP_Volume3 #58119
VB Splitter

VB Splitter is a developer-friendly ActiveX control to allow the user to resize docked controls at run-time. You can now have a splitting-capability for any number of controls with only one VB Splitter control and one line of code in your program. The control has 11 properties, 2 methods and 7 events customly made for your pleasure. It's very well-commented and has a strong encapsulation technic that making this control an author-friendly ActiveX control. Just don't miss the demo (open the VB Splitter Demo.vbg). Your feedback and vote will be very appreciated. Thanks in advance.

ASP_Volume3 #58125
SoftButtonCtl

A simple soft button control

ASP_Volume3 #58134
Display Checkboxes in Listbox Horizontally

Display Checkboxes in Listbox Horizontally I've been searching the internet and PSC on how to display checkboxes in a listbox in a horizontal manner but I didn't found any. Perhaps my search keywords are wrong but really I found nothing. I decided to re-examine the listbox property if I can find something that I have overlooked before and there it is. Who would have thought that by merely CHANGING THE COLUMNS PROPERTY TO ANY NUMBER OTHER THAN 0 WOULD ACCOMPLISH WHAT I WANTED TO DO. Many of you may have already known this but for newbies out there, this might help. See the screenshot to see what I mean. For the screenshot below, the setting is: Listbox1.columns = 4 OR In the properties list, change Columns = 0 to Columns = any number you want. The number of columns specified will configure the listbox to show 4 columns in its display window. A horizontal scrollbar will be displayed if the data display occupies more than 4 columns.

ASP_Volume3 #58192
xp style

i did some changes to the code but the credit is to douglass sheffer. is his code not asking for votes or anything. i am working on xp style controls as well and custom basic controls. in c++ as well as vb. if you like let me know. the original code is at http://planetsourcecode.com/vb/scripts/ShowCode.asp?txtCodeId=30137&lngWId=1

ASP_Volume3 #58211
Cool ToolTip Notify for System Tray

This code will popup a little notify window in near the system tray! It uses a transparent form and is movable by the user. Take it easy on this newbie ;0) This is my first code submission.

ASP_Volume3 #58215
Formatted Label

The FormattedLabel acts as a standart label control, but by placing commands within the caption, you can display different font effects. Different commands allow you to change bold, italic, underline, strikethru and color styles and insert line breaks. The control also features AutoSize and WordWrap. But i can't do it with transparent background. Buuuu. :o) Hi folks. I change tags to html like but without color tag. In declaration part of UserControl there is constants like CONST cBoldStart = "". You can change tags there but they must by among . Thanks to all for your reqest and tips. p.s. I hope than my programing is better then my english. Sorry :o))))

ASP_Volume3 #58256
Form gradient using three only lines of code

This is how to use gradient colors in a form. You do not need to do anything or write lines of code to add gradient to your forms. Just put the these three lines in Form_Load Sub Update Note: Thanks for comments, Form_Resize is a better sub if your form is not fixed size

ASP_Volume3 #58262
CommandBar

This is a remake of vbAccelerator's CommandBar Control. In this version, everything is included in one ActiveX control, so no dependencies (like SSubTimer and vbaImLst) required.

ASP_Volume3 #58263
ToolBar And Rebar Control

This is remake of vbAccelerator's Toolbar and Rebar Control. In this control everything is included in one ActiveX, so no external dependencies (like SSubTmr.DLL) is required.

ASP_Volume3 #58314
DoknSplitz - SDI/MDI Forms Docking Project

DoknSplitz is an ActiveX control which integrates resize, move, show/hide of design time controls as well as provide runtime forms docking & undocking capability for SDI/MDI apps. This project is a supersized version of TheoZ's VB Control Manager(txtCodeId=49621). Special care taken to ensure backward compatibility with TheoZ's events & properties where possible. Package includes source for ActiveX control, SDI demo, and MDI demo apps. Developed with VB6sp6 on WinXPsp2. Demo tests included IE6 and IE7. Acknowledgements, History, and Notes located in docs\*.htm help files. Zip 190 KB. Constructive suggestions and requests always welcome. Thanks again TheoZ!

ASP_Volume3 #58325
Sort Listview Columns Numerically

Tired of windows "numerical" listview sorting? 1 11 2 222 Well now you can sort your listview using true numerics! 1 2 11 222 An easy to use module, just one function to call on! Enjoy ;-) Feedback is appreciated!

ASP_Volume3 #58338
Outlook 2003 SideBar V1.6 Final (Update 25 Aug 2004)

A Complete Implementation Of The Outlook 2003 Sidebar Control. Now Version 1.4 Too Many Updates To Mention Take A Look. This Code Is Completely Free, But If You Use It Please Credit The Me, Alot Of Time And Effort Has Went Into This Code. As Always Comments and Constructive Criticism Is Always Welcome. Kind Regards Gary ___________________________________________________ Updated: 24 Aug 2004 Fixed: The Large Icon No Draws Properly On The Toolbar. Added New Propery: Display Chevron Menu. Gives The Developer Control On Wether Or No The To Show The Popup Menu. Control Version updated To Version 1.5 Kind Regards Gary ____________________________________________________ Updated: 25 Aug 2004 This Is The Final Update I Will Be Posting.(Until I Get More Time) Added: Caption Font Property, Item Selected Color Property. Changed The Menu Chevron Color Appearance To Look More Like The Outlook 2003 Sidebar Chevron Button. Cleaned Up The Code And Set Version To 1.6 Kind Regards Gary

ASP_Volume3 #58339
Phantom Panel Selector (Updated 17/07/2005)

A Fully Owner Drawn Dependency Free Side Panel Selector Control, With Three Different Drawing Styles: Standard, StandardX And Simulated MSN Messenger Styles. Various Options Include: Show Tooltips,Tooltip Style, Custom Color, Left To Right Support etc... Add Different Controls To Each Panel. Thanks Goto: Vlad For His Drawing Class and Paul Caton For His Awesome subclassing Code. Take A Look At The Screen Shot I think It Speaks For Its Self. As Always Constructive Comments And Critisims Are Welcome. Gary. _____________________________________________________ Updated:12/07/2005 - Added Mask Color For Icons/Pictures - ReStructured The Messenger Style Drawing Routine. - Messenger Style Panel Rect Bug Fix. _____________________________________________________ Updated: 15/07/2005 Minor Cosmetic Changes: When In Messenger And Standard Drawstyle The Bottom Righthand Of The Control Was Missing A Pixel. Embedded Control Height Was Wrong Height, When In Messenger Draw Style (Height Was Not To Exact Scale When You Resized The Icons) Cleaned Up Code A little And Set Version to V1.02 _____________________________________________________ Updated: 17/07/2005 : Very Minor Change, Changed The Transparent Backcolor Of The Selected Panel. When Drawing In Messenger Style. (Thanks Goto Riccardo Cohen For Pointing Out This Bug) _____________________________________________________

ASP_Volume3 #58340
VSNet Property Tree (Alpha)

A Fully Ownerdrawn Implemetation Of A VSNet Style Property Tree (Supporting Nested Levels). Supports: Picture Object,Common Dialogs (Open,Browse etc), Font Object, Custom Lists,Spin Button, Nested Levels blah blah blah.... There Is No Calander Support As Yet But You Can Format Each Property Item and Validate It Before Updateing. Caveats: No For Each Suuport And No Delete On Property Items But you Can Clear and Reload. List Only Need To Be Created Once and And As Many Property Item(s) you Like Can Be Pointed To It. I'm Not Going To Bore You With Anymore Details, Check The Screen Shot And download The Code. A Big Thanks Goes To Paul Caton For the Hook Code, Vlad Vissoultchev For The Drawing Code, Fred Cpp For The isButton And Carles PV For His Coolist. Notes Before Use: You Must Copy The WinsubHook2.tlb To Your System Folder. As Always Comments and Constructive Critism Is Always Welcome. The Sample Included Is A Basic Sample But I Will Update When I have More Time. Note: This Has Only Been Tested On XP Pro And Home SP2 I Would Like To Know If It Works On Other Os's Kind Regards Gary

ASP_Volume3 #58341
Outlook 2003 SideBar V2.02 Alpha (*Updated 10/02/2005*)

A complete new rebuild of my award winning EyeDropper Control. Now a 100% Dependency free control. Better Drawing, Better Font handling, No Dependencies, Better menu Handling... to many to mention. The control now uses subclassing from Paul Caton (thanks Paul) And the cMemdc for drawing From Vlad Vissoultchev (Thanks Vlad) Awesome code From two very talented programmers. Take a look and tell me what you think. As Always comments and constructive critisim is always welcome. Note: 1) You MUST Copy the WinSubHook.tlb Located in then tlb folder to you system folder. 2) The Control Doesn't Support 32bit Alpha Icons As Yet (Vlad If You have Any Idea on how to do this - I Would Be Very Interested indeed) Regards Gary ___________________________________________________ Update: 09/02/2005 Resizing Of Containers Where Causeing A Flicker. Now Sorted. Toolbar Items Now Draw And Display The Same As The Original MSOutlook Sidebar. ___________________________________________________ Update: 10/02/2005 Disabled Icons Now Render To Grey. Fixed The Max Visible Items On Redraw/Resize. Fixed Toolbar Drawing (Icons Not Displayed Correctly When Sizing. Added Custom Color Property(As A Trial). Enjoy. Thanks Gary

Languages
Top Categories
Global Discovery